What to look for

The purchase of a sofa is a major investment, so you want to make sure you pick one that is a good fit for your lifestyle and is built to last. Achieving your budget is an excellent place to begin, but it's also important to consider how you will use the sofa and who will be using it. For example, a three-seater sofa in a formal living space could be more suitable for vintage couch for Sale adults than a more family-friendly sectional that will see lots of relaxation and TV watching from pets and children.

The frame and suspension system of a sofa is an excellent way to determine its quality. A sturdy frame made from kiln-dried or engineered wood is more durable than plywood, which is susceptible to sagging with time. The type of joinery is also important, with mortise-and-tenon or dovetail designs providing the most stability.

The fabric you select determines how long a couch will last. Fabrics with stain guards woven into the fibers can be used in areas that are heavily trafficked. They also can endure the effects of moisture and frequent use. If you're worried about pet or child spills choose a sofa with covers that can be removed and are machine washable.

Fabrics

Couches come in a variety of fabrics, ranging from microfiber and wool to velvet and. A lot of people prefer natural fabrics such as cotton and linen, which are eco-friendly and air-tight. Others choose synthetic fabrics that are durable and easy to maintain. However, no couch material is perfect and all require a level of maintenance in time.

When choosing a sofa fabric it is essential to think about the durability and ease of maintenance as well as colorfastness. Some of the most durable fabrics include microfiber, polyester (which can be mixed with other fibers to make it appear more luxurious) Chenille, performance Chenille and Crypton (which are both water and stain resistant).

Other choices for fabric couches include silk, which can provide a high level of luxury that may be worth the cost and linen which is soft and breathable. However, even these sturdy fabrics require a certain amount of care in the long term and are not resistant to abrasions or pilling.

When you are choosing a sofa it is important to consider its ability to resist sun damage and fade. These elements can alter the shade of a couch and its texture over time. Cushions

It can be a challenge to choose the right cushions for a sofa. They're the place you sit, so you'll need them to be comfortable and look good, but you also have to think about how the couch will be used. A good cushion filling will assist you in achieving both. But, it's important to consider the style and size of your sofa as well as its location prior to making a choice.

Look for cushions with an elevated loft and that are well cushioned. This means they have a firm feel and are easy to sink into. It is also important to think about the kind of material that will are used to make your cushions. For example, if you're looking for a cheap option polyester is a good option. It's soft, and it holds its shape well. But if you want something more extravagant and luxurious, then 100% down-filled pillows are worth the extra cost.

Style

Sofas are the centerpiece of a lot of living rooms. They're where family members gather during parties and movie nights, and are where pets and children spread out to relax. So, couches should be durable and comfortable with a mix of high-performance fabric, cushions and frames that will stand the test of time.

Look at the frame and legs of the couch to determine its quality. The frames of cheap sectional couches for sale couches are made of plastic or particleboard, whereas the frames of premium couches are made from wood that has been kiln dried. Look for mortise and tenon joinery. Avoid engineered wood, which is more brittle and is susceptible to cracking at different temperatures. Also consider the spring suspension and the amount of cushion fill there is. A sofa that is cheap may skip springs and instead use webbing, while a high-end Vintage Couch For Sale (Www.Google.Gr) will have eight-way hand-tied springs.

Then, you need to consider whether the style of furniture is appropriate for your lifestyle and space. For instance, high-back couches tend to lean traditional while low-back sofas are sleeker and contemporary. Sofas come in many shapes, such as loveseats, daybeds and modular sectionals. You can combine the pieces to create your ideal configuration. Some sofas feature distinctive features like reclining seats, integrated storage and replaceable cover.
